The revelations keep coming in the Michael Jackson-AEG case, with the latest coming from his former tour director, Kenny Ortega - who wrote in a letter to the concert promoter that Jacko was in danger of hurting himself. According to the Los Angeles Times, the letter, sent to AEG head Randy Phillips, was presented to the jury on Monday.
Eight Mile Style, the music publishing company for Eminem, has sued Facebook for copyright infringement. The firm claims that the social networking site used music during an April advertisement that sounded "substantially similar" to Eminem's track "Under The Influence." The company responded by noting that the song is a rip-off of a Michael Jackson song.

T.I. has released the music video for "Wit Me," a new single via his Hustle Gang imprint, EMPIRE Distribution. The track features Lil Wayne and serves as a teaser for the pair's upcoming America's Most Wanted Music Festival. In the vid, directed by Phillyflyboy, Tip and Weezy race through the streets of Miami, hit the water in yachts and run from the police.

Will.i.am has released the music video for "Bang Bang," a cut from his recently released album, #willpower. In the black-and-white clip, the Black Eyed Peas fronter dons a coat and tails for a roaring '20s vibe. Suitably, the single is also featured on the soundtrack for the film, The Great Gatsby, starring Leonardo DiCaprio and Carey Mulligan.

Kanye West's forthcoming release will be titled Yeezus, according to a report from Rap-Up. The release is planned for June 18 and will be Kanye's first solo effort since 2010's My Beautiful Dark Twisted Fantasy. There has been no confirmation on the title from Ye, though he has already premiered three tracks from the new album.
Drake has unveiled a new look, rocking a full afro for a cameo in the upcoming film Anchorman 2. Images of Drizzy on the set hit the web via Rap-Up.com and show the former DiGrassi star decked out in a vintage Members Only jacket, old-school stonewashed jeans and Adidas high-tops. So far, there's no word on the nature of Drake's role in the highly anticipated sequel.
